THE Hiritano highway between Epo and Kerema in the Gulf province will see its completion following the signing of contract No. NPC/19-0013 awarded to Dekenai Construction at the Government House recently.

The signing marks the remaining road that has yet to be sealed as part of Road Maintenance and Rehabilitation Project (RMRP) II funded by the World Bank.

Dekenai Construction was awarded K46,629,271.54 for the contract.

The Secretary for Works David Wereh was present to sign the contract on behalf of the department. The Governor of Gulf, Chris Haiveta was also present to witness the signing.  

In appreciation for the continued support and effort in the sealing of the highway between his electorate and the nation’s capital, Governor Haiveta shared his thanks to acknowledge the work put in.

“We, the people in my electorate, are grateful that the remaining portion now between Kerema and Port Moresby will be sealed. I want to thank the Marape-Basil Government for continuing projects that are donor-funded, which is a low-hanging fruit for project implementation.”

“We will work with the contractor to ensure that we fast track the project, a 15-month project to seal about 15km of the remaining road left. So by the time its finished and we have a sealed road all the way from Port Moresby to Kerema, we can work towards creating economic development along this road corridor. Kerema town does not have land and so we intend to expand down towards where the project is set to take place.”

A monumental rehabilitation project that is set to see completion, its implementation is expected to commence soon now that the relevant parties have signed the contract.

Meanwhile, a second contract was also awarded to Dekenai during the signing as well, valued at K42,057,264.69, Contract No. NPC/19-0012, which focuses on the sealing and associated drainage works on the Coastal Highway from Bogia to Awar in Madang province.
